<Abstract>An efficient one-pot oxidation/condensation tandem process has been developed for the synthesis of 2-substituted benzimidazole derivatives from benzylic alcohols and 1,2-phenylenediamine with use of urea-hydrogen peroxide/silica phosphoric acid  as a bifunctional catalyst. This method provides a rapid and efficient access to 2-substituted benzimidazoles.</Abstract>
